The role of a Restaurant General Manager at KFC is a pivotal leadership position responsible for driving the success of one of the franchise's independently owned and operated restaurants. This position requires a hands-on leader dedicated to inspiring and mentoring the KFC team while ensuring the delivery of outstanding guest experiences. As the number one leader within the restaurant, the General Manager oversees all operational facets, including managing staff, monitoring financial performance, and maintaining compliance with company policies. The role demands a customer-focused mindset, operational excellence, and the ability to cultivate a supportive team environment.

As a Restaurant General Manager, you are entrusted with ownership of your restaurant's success metrics, accountable for meeting and exceeding goals relating to sales, customer service, and operational efficiency. Leading by example, you champion high standards of cleanliness, food quality, and friendly guest interactions. You play a critical role in growing and mentoring your KFC family by providing structured training, onboarding new team members, and facilitating ongoing development. Communication is key as you lead your team through business updates, upcoming promotions, and goal setting to ensure alignment and motivation.

Your leadership extends to fostering a positive and collaborative atmosphere where teamwork thrives and every team member feels valued. Collaboration with other General Managers and Area Leaders is essential to drive business growth and continuous improvement across the franchise. Daily operational responsibilities include reviewing payroll, completing employee onboarding and termination paperwork, managing work schedules to balance service and cost-effectiveness, and ensuring a safe and clean store environment at all times.

Running the store smoothly requires attention to detail with record-keeping of financial and production activities. You maintain documentation as required by Area Coaches, Directors of Operations, and Human Resources to ensure compliance with company standards.
